阿里云运维架构实践秘籍

阿里云运维架构实践秘籍

查阅电子书
手机扫码
  • 微信扫一扫

    关注微信公众号

因版权原因待上架

编辑推荐

云端运维架构实践的十八招绝技,覆盖二十余款热门云产品实践,五十余中常见开源热门技术实践。

内容简介

本书内容主要分为四大篇:云端基础篇、云端选项篇、云端安全篇、云端架构篇。总共十八个章节,所以作者把本书的内容称为云端实践秘籍“降云十八掌”。

本书内容主要为历时八年、累积云端五千余家一线互联网企业实践干货及经验,包含云端二十余款热门产品实践、五十余项常见开源热门技术实践,以及云端最热门技术:云端监控、云端DevOps/云端容器、云端智能运维等的最佳实践。内容风格上,以案例、场景、实践经验为主。杜绝一些无关痛痒的软件安装、参数配置等充篇幅的内容。减少理论,偏向干货。

作者简介

作者乔锐杰,阿里云MVP,江湖人称“乔帮主”,阿里云资深架构师/技术专家。国内云端架构与运维实践开拓者,曾主导过电商、金融、政府、视频、游戏等领域千万级云端架构,在云端分布式集群架构、云端运维、云端安全等方面有着丰富的实战经验。和众多80后一样,从竞技类游戏“红警”、“星际争霸”开始接触互联网。2001年便参加“中美黑客大战”,从“盗号”、“网络攻击”进入计算机专业领域,以及后来开班授徒开始传授分享互联网安全攻防经验。曾担任黑客讲师/Java高级讲师/Python讲师/运维高级讲师/阿里云讲师,从事过安全、研发、高级运维、架构师等大半个互联网相关技术职位,现担任驻云科技运维总监兼阿里云架构师。

章节目录

版权信息

推荐序

前言

绪言 云计算带来的技术变革

第一篇 云端选型篇

第1章 云平台的选型

1.1 全球云厂商占比

1.2 国内云厂商的现状

1.2.1 阿里云

1.2.2 腾讯云

1.2.3 华为云

1.2.4 百度云

1.2.5 其他云厂商

第2章 云产品的选型

2.1 阿里云产品概要

2.2 云产品的8/2选择原则

2.2.1 五个技术优势

2.2.2 两个非技术优势

2.2.3 选择自建环境的条件

第3章 软件技术选型

3.1 “宇宙最火”的语言

3.2 硬件的天下

3.3 “后台强大”的语言

3.4 “胶水语言”

3.5 “世界上最好”的语言

3.6 最适合高并发的语言

3.7 唯一的前后端语言

3.8 不可替代的机器语言

第4章 系统技术选型

4.1 云端网络的三种选型策略

4.1.1 策略一:网络类型选型的五个注意点

4.1.2 策略二:入网请求选型的四种方法

4.1.3 策略三:出网请求选型的三种方法

4.2 云端Web服务器的五点选型考虑

4.2.1 考虑一:稳定性

4.2.2 考虑二:性能

4.2.3 考虑三:对负载均衡功能的支持

4.2.4 考虑四:前端静态数据缓存

4.2.5 考虑五:丰富的插件及支持灵活的二次开发

4.3 云端负载均衡选型的五个方面

4.3.1 对比方面:四大热门负载均衡的优缺点

4.3.2 分类方面:五大类型负载均衡的原理场景详解

4.3.3 演变方面:负载均衡的两种演变

4.3.4 性能方面:负载均衡隐藏的性能秘密

4.3.5 选型方面:云端负载均衡的两种选型

4.4 云端存储的四种类型

4.4.1 类型一:块存储

4.4.2 类型二:共享块存储

4.4.3 类型三:共享文件存储

4.4.4 类型四:对象存储

4.5 云端缓存的两大选型秘籍

4.5.1 秘籍一:云端静态缓存唯一的选型

4.5.2 秘籍二:云端动态缓存唯一的选型

4.6 云端数据库选型的三个方面

4.6.1 分类方面:数据库的三大分类

4.6.2 性能方面:数据库的性能秘密

4.6.3 选型方面:云端数据库选型的两点考虑及一个步骤

第5章 配置选型

5.1 衡量业务量的指标

5.1.1 一台Tomcat跑两亿PV的笑话

5.1.2 衡量业务量的指标

5.2 业务访问量与性能压力指标的转换

5.2.1 指标转换原理

5.2.2 性能指标转换计算模型实践

5.2.3 业务指标转换计算模型实践

5.3 云端服务器配置模型

5.3.1 PV量对应的服务器配置

5.3.2 服务器CPU/内存配置模型

5.4 云端带宽配置选型

5.4.1 带宽配置估算模型

5.4.2 带宽类型选择的8/2原则

第二篇 云端实践篇

第6章 云主机实践

6.1 云网络下的业务新架构

6.2 云的技术本质优势

6.2.1 云主机与硬件服务器性能对比的误区

6.2.2 云的本质优势在于分布式架构

6.3 云时代下的资源自动化管理

第7章 云端负载均衡实践

7.1 “1+1>2”经典架构

7.2 单机+SLB架构的必要性

7.3 被LBHA误导的架构

7.4 DNS的两大主流实践

7.4.1 实践一:不推荐DNS作为负载均衡的误区

7.4.2 实践二:DNS不为人知的核心秘密功能

7.5 企业级Web架构实践

7.6 企业级负载均衡架构实践

7.6.1 七层SLB性能实践案例

7.6.2 互联网企业负载均衡架构实践

7.6.3 云端负载均衡中小型架构实践

7.6.4 云端负载均衡中大型架构实践

7.7 通过代理+VPN提速跨国际网络访问

7.7.1 跨国际网络访问的延时问题

7.7.2 解决跨国际网络访问的代理架构

7.8 通过反向代理提速跨国际网站访问

7.8.1 方案一:双域名反向代理架构方案

7.8.2 方案二:单域名反向代理架构方案

第8章 云端存储实践

8.1 云端块存储八大实践技巧

8.1.1 提升云盘I/O的三大技巧

8.1.2 云盘使用的五大技巧

8.2 云端共享文件存储的五种方法

8.2.1 方法一:Rsync文件共享实践

8.2.2 方法二:Rsync+Inotify文件共享实践

8.2.3 方法三:NFS文件共享实践

8.2.4 方法四:NAS文件共享实践

8.2.5 方法五:OSS文件共享实践

8.3 OSS文件管理的六大技巧

8.3.1 技巧一:使用API接口/SDK管理OSS

8.3.2 技巧二:使用阿里云管理控制台管理OSS

8.3.3 技巧三:使用图形化工具管理OSS

8.3.4 技巧四:使用本地文件系统挂载管理OSS

8.3.5 技巧五:使用FTP管理OSS

8.3.6 技巧六:使用命令行工具管理OSS

8.4 四招搞定OSS数据迁移

8.4.1 第一招:OSSImport工具

8.4.2 第二招:OSS在线迁移服务

8.4.3 第三招:跨区域复制

8.4.4 第四招:OSS离线迁移

8.5 运维容灾备份新篇章

第9章 云端缓存实践

9.1 使用静态缓存提升网站性能的四种方法

9.1.1 方法一:浏览器缓存

9.1.2 方法二:磁盘缓存

9.1.3 方法三:内存缓存

9.1.4 方法四:CDN(动静分离)

9.2 动态缓存的三种应用场景实践

9.2.1 场景一:数据库缓存

9.2.2 场景二:集中Session管理的六种策略

9.2.3 场景三:四招搞定动态页面缓存

第10章 云端数据库实践

10.1 垂直拆库三大应用场景实践

10.1.1 场景一:垂直拆库的应用实践

10.1.2 场景二:主从的四种实践方案

10.1.3 场景三:集群技术的应用实践

10.2 水平拆表三大应用场景实践

10.2.1 场景一:业务层水平分区拆表的三种方式

10.2.2 场景二:数据库层次水平分区拆表的方法

10.2.3 场景三:四大成熟分布式Sharding技术方案

第11章 云端运维实践

11.1 上云迁移的实践

11.1.1 上云的诉求

11.1.2 前期技术调研

11.1.3 三大运维痛点

11.1.4 上云迁移的挑战性

11.1.5 七步搞定上云迁移

11.1.6 上云前后的对比

11.2 混合云八大运维架构实践

11.2.1 混合云实践1:基于VPC+专线构建混合云架构

11.2.2 混合云实践2:RDS自建主从同步在混合云中的实践

11.2.3 混合云实践3:MongoDB副本集在混合云中的实践

11.2.4 混合云实践4:RabbitMQ+SLB高可用实践

11.2.5 混合云实践5:云端自建DNS实践

11.2.6 混合云实践6:Redis主从+Sentinel+Consul+DNSmasq高可用实践

11.2.7 混合云实践7:MySQL主从+Consul+DNSmasq高可用实践

11.2.8 混合云实践8:关于DNS的高可用

11.3 云端运维架构五大优化

11.3.1 优化一:云端配置选型

11.3.2 优化二:云端网络架构

11.3.3 优化三:云端负载均衡的选择

11.3.4 优化四:云端静态资源访问

11.3.5 优化五:云端运维管理

第12章 云端监控实践

12.1 物理机体系:三大监控方案实践

12.1.1 监控方案一:Shell/Python

12.1.2 监控方案二:Nagios

12.1.3 监控方案三:Nagios+Cacti

12.2 云计算体系:四大监控方案实践

12.2.1 监控方案四:Zabbix

12.2.2 监控方案五:云监控

12.2.3 监控方案六:驻云监控1.0(集群监控)

12.2.4 监控方案七:驻云监控2.0(自动化监控)

12.3 容器体系:四大监控方案实践

12.3.1 监控方案八:Prometheus+Alertmanager+Grafana

12.3.2 监控方案九:TICK技术栈

12.3.3 监控方案十:驻云监控3.0(容器体系监控)

12.3.4 监控方案十一:驻云监控3.1(智能监控)

第13章 云端容器/DevOps实践

13.1 云端容器技术的十二大实践

13.1.1 容器实践1:关于云端容器资源编排技术的选择

13.1.2 容器实践2:结合K8S的DevOps流程

13.1.3 容器实践3:关于K8S集群的配置

13.1.4 容器实践4:K8S云端部署架构

13.1.5 容器实践5:K8S插件之DNS

13.1.6 容器实践6:容器的Web管理控制台

13.1.7 容器实践7:K8S业务应用+自建DNS实践

13.1.8 容器实践8:K8S Master节点高可用

13.1.9 容器实践9:K8S Node节点高可用

13.1.10 容器实践10:K8S部署架构优化

13.1.11 容器实践11:自建K8S迁移阿里云K8S托管版+Rancher

13.1.12 容器实践12:K8S监控实践

13.2 DevOps发展的四个阶段

13.2.1 人工阶段

13.2.2 脚本及工具阶段

13.2.3 平台化阶段

13.2.4 智能化阶段

第三篇 云端安全篇

第14章 云端安全面临的挑战和机遇

14.1 云端安全问题的现状

14.2 云端安全面临的三大挑战

14.2.1 挑战一:安全行业状态不容乐观

14.2.2 挑战二:云端安全环境复杂化的挑战

14.2.3 挑战三:安全对云优势的冲击

14.3 云端安全带来的两大机遇

14.3.1 机遇一:云计算、大数据将成为安全体系的基础核心保障

14.3.2 机遇二:政策驱动叠加,使得行业将迎来爆发

第15章 云端黑客常见攻击

15.1 什么是黑客

15.2 黑客入侵的途径:漏洞

15.3 黑客入侵流程

15.4 黑客常见系统层攻击

15.5 黑客常见应用层攻击

15.6 黑客常见网络层攻击

第16章 云端安全最佳防御方案

16.1 云端常见黑客攻击的防御

16.1.1 四款热门的云端安全产品

16.1.2 安骑士、WAF、态势感知三大使用误区

16.1.3 DDoS和WAF三大实践技巧

16.2 云端安全架构四大策略实践

16.2.1 策略一:云平台架构模式选择

16.2.2 策略二:分布式架构是安全保障的基石

16.2.3 策略三:全面开启云产品的安全机制

16.2.4 策略四:基于VPC的企业级安全架构

16.3 云端运维安全实践十则

16.3.1 第一则:云端堡垒机的三种实践

16.3.2 第二则:运维用户管理

16.3.3 第三则:密码安全管理

16.3.4 第四则:防火墙安全管理

16.3.5 第五则:端口安全管理

16.3.6 第六则:云端开源WAF实践

16.3.7 第七则:云端数据安全传输的标准

16.3.8 第八则:运维安全性能调优的三种方法

16.3.9 第九则:通过冷备及热备进一步保障云端数据安全性

16.3.10 第十则:加强安全巡检及安全培训管理

16.4 云端防御综合案例总结

第四篇 云端架构篇

第17章 云端千万级架构的演变

17.1 架构原始阶段:万能的单机

17.2 架构基础阶段:物理分离Web和数据库

17.3 架构动静分离阶段:静态缓存+对象存储

17.4 架构分布式阶段:负载均衡

17.5 架构数据缓存阶段:数据库缓存

17.6 架构扩展阶段:垂直扩展

17.7 架构分布式+大数据阶段:水平扩展

第18章 云端架构的应用

18.1 云端电商架构应用

18.1.1 业务特点:活动

18.1.2 业务特点:商品图片

18.2 云端游戏架构应用

18.3 云端移动社交架构应用

18.4 云端金融架构应用

阿里云运维架构实践秘籍是2020年由机械工业出版社华章分社出版,作者驻云科技。

得书感谢您对《阿里云运维架构实践秘籍》关注和支持,如本书内容有不良信息或侵权等情形的,请联系本网站。

购买这本书

你可能喜欢
VMwarevSphere6.0虚拟化架构实战指南 电子书
本书语言通俗易懂,可操作性强,适用于VMware vSphere 6.0虚拟化架构管理人员,并可作为VCP 6考试的参考资料。
人工智能云平台:原理、设计与应用 电子书
从原理到应用,全面、深入地学习人工智能云平台。
智慧环保实践 电子书
第一篇讲述了智慧环保概述、智慧环保的支撑技术、智慧环保建设的必要性内容,第二篇讲述了环保物联网的建设、环保云计算平台建设、环境保护地理信息系统.、环境数据中心建设、环境监测在线平台(系统)建设、环境监察移动执法系统建设、污染源自动监控系统建设、环保应急指挥系统建设的内容,第三篇完全通过案例对智慧环保实践进行了解读。
腹部外科实践 电子书
一部以临床实践为主要特色的学术著作。
HBase入门与实践 电子书
大数据时代快速上手HBase行动指南。